Creator Collective Platform

"Creator Collective" is a subscription-based marketplace platform that connects micro-influencers and content creators with local businesses seeking affordable promotional partnerships. It addresses the challenge small businesses face in accessing influencer marketing while enabling creators to monetize their reach without relying solely on large brands. What sets it apart is its AI-driven matchmaking system that pairs creators with businesses based on niche, audience demographics, and engagement metrics, fostering authentic collaborations that benefit both parties.

Market Potential Analysis

Score: 80/100

The influencer marketing industry is growing rapidly, with a shift towards micro-influencers who offer higher engagement rates at lower costs. Local businesses increasingly seek cost-effective marketing solutions, providing a strong market opportunity.

Competition Analysis

Score: 65/100

The market has several players like AspireIQ and Tribe, but few focus on micro-influencers for local businesses. Existing competitors have larger brand focus, giving Creator Collective a niche advantage.

AspireIQ

Influencer marketing platform connecting brands with influencers.

Strengths: Established user base, Comprehensive tools

Weaknesses: Focus on larger brands

Tribe

Platform for brands to connect with micro-influencers.

Strengths: Strong brand partnerships

Weaknesses: Higher cost for small businesses
